Qin Senior Sister was left speechless by what I said, but she couldn't let it go, so she resorted to a stubborn tactic: "I don't care, you have to get me a new Amulet!" 0
 
I was quite annoyed by her persistence and replied, "Fine, I'll have my Second Uncle send a little ghost over for your sister to raise. I guarantee her boyfriend will come running back to beg for forgiveness. But I have to warn you, raising a little ghost comes with many taboos. If she breaks any rules and something happens, don't come whining to me. With one slap, I could turn you into Yang Guifei, believe it or not?" 0
 
The classmates burst into laughter, and Qin Senior Sister could no longer stay; embarrassed and angry, she turned and ran away. Liang Xi grinned at me with admiration and said, "You're amazing! Qin Senior Sister is the belle of the Chinese Department. People would kill to just talk to her, and you're talking about turning her into Yang Guifei." 0
 
I shrugged and put the Amulet in my pocket, saying, "What’s there to fear in business? The only thing to fear is someone throwing dirt at you. If I let her win this time, how am I supposed to survive in the future?" 0
 
The classmates gathered around due to the earlier argument, all chattering about whether what Liang Xi said was true. Did someone really go to Thailand and meet an Ajan Master who raises little ghosts? By the way, where has Zhang Qichao been lately? 0
 
For the first few questions, Liang Xi answered enthusiastically, but the last one left him completely speechless. Neither of us felt like responding as we sat in our chairs looking glum. 0
 
After a while, several boys suddenly burst into the classroom, shouting, "Who’s selling Amulets!" 0
 
I looked up at them; I didn’t recognize any of them and couldn’t be bothered. But some helpful classmates pointed me out. The boys rushed over and slapped my desk, saying, "You’re the one who sold that fake Amulet to Qin?" 0
 
I pushed my chair back slightly, took off my jacket, rolled up my sleeves, and grabbed a mop from behind the classroom door. The boys looked confused and exchanged glances, not understanding what I was doing. Once everything was ready, I walked up to them and asked, "One-on-one or a group fight?" 0
 
They were startled and quickly clarified, "We’re not here to fight! We heard that Qin returned that Amulet to you?" 0
 
I looked at them and asked, "What’s going on? Are you here asking for money?" 0
 
"No, no," one of them laughed nervously. "That small amount of money isn’t worth it. I'm here to buy an Amulet from you. The one that Qin gave you. Whatever she paid for it, I'll pay you the same." 0
 
"Don't try that with me; I thought of this first. You can leave," another guy pulled him back and smiled at me. "Junior, I'll give you an extra hundred; sell it to me." 0
 
"Go play somewhere else! The Amulet that Qin Senior Sister had might still carry her scent! Three hundred is more like a dog collar! I'll offer four hundred!" another shouted. 0
 
"Four hundred sounds too low; Junior, I'll give you five hundred!" someone squeezed in from the side. 0
 
In the blink of an eye, that Queen Nang Phaya Buddha Authentic in Second Uncle's hands—costing just over a hundred—was being bid up to eight hundred. Eight hundred in 2006 wasn’t a small amount; if I sold it now, my profit would multiply six or seven times right on the spot. The surrounding classmates were stunned; even though Qin Senior Sister deemed it a fake Amulet, someone was willing to pay eight hundred for it. 0
 
 
I was also a bit stunned, finally believing that the saying "a woman's beauty can make a man lose his intelligence" is true. 0
 
The senior who offered eight hundred was staring at me, waiting for a response. I was momentarily taken aback and asked him, "Really eight hundred to buy?" 0
 
He nodded eagerly, like a chick pecking at rice. It's hard to find someone willing to be a fool with money; what more could I say? I took out the Amulet right there. The senior blinked and was about to reach out to grab it when I pulled my hand back and asked, "Where's the money? According to Thai Ajarn Master's rules, it's cash first, then goods." 0
 
The senior looked a bit embarrassed and said, "Well, junior, you see, I didn't bring enough today. I'll get it next time we meet..." 0
 
"Trying to get something for nothing..." I chuckled and asked, "What about that guy who offered seven hundred? Does he still want it?" 0
 
The senior immediately panicked: "No, no, junior! Wait for me! Just ten minutes! No, no, five minutes! I'll be right back!" 0
 
With that, he dashed off, reminding me not to sell it to anyone offering a lower price. I didn't care; this Amulet had caused me enough trouble that whether I sold it or not didn't matter. If worse came to worst, I could just give it to Liang Xi or Hu Xiaoyi; it wasn't worth much anyway. 0
 
In less than five minutes, the senior returned, panting heavily and pulling out a wad of cash from his pocket. There were several one-hundred bills, a few fifties, mostly twenties and tens, and I even spotted four five-dollar bills. I couldn't help but laugh and asked, "Did you run to the convenience store for this?" 0
 
The senior looked a bit embarrassed, his face flushed as he stared longingly at the Amulet in my hand. I felt like I was holding a piece of meat being eyed by a hungry dog; a chill ran down my spine as I quickly handed the Amulet over to him. He took it with both hands like it was a treasure and left laughing heartily. Anyone who didn't know would think he had just won five million. 0
 
As I gathered up the stack of cash on the table, I sensed some resentment from the other seniors who had offered slightly lower prices. They looked at me with disappointment. I shrugged and said, "Profit comes first. Next time, make sure you bring enough money. If Qin Senior Sister returns anything one day, I'll let you know." 0
 
Upon hearing this, they all perked up with excitement and left their phone numbers behind before departing eagerly. Looking at this group of young people blinded by love, I really wanted to send Second Uncle a text saying: "School is full of fools with money; come quickly!" 0
 
However, Second Uncle deals in high-end business; sometimes selling a top-tier Amulet and having an Ajan visit clients can cost hundreds of thousands. My few hundred bucks were nothing compared to that. 0
 
Liang Xi watched everything unfold and admired me even more. An Amulet that had been returned could sell for four times its original price—how impressive! 0
 
His words reminded me that when Qin Senior Sister left, she hadn't taken back that two hundred dollars. Now that I'd sold her Amulet for eight hundred, morally speaking, I should compensate her. 0
 
On my way to the cafeteria after school, I pulled out my phone to call Second Uncle to ask if he had any cheaper yet effective Authentic ones. Before I could say anything, I felt someone kick my calf and heard a woman shout: "Shen Yi! You jerk!" 0
 
Turning around, I saw Qin Senior Sister glaring at me angrily. It turned out that the fool who bought the Amulet was bragging everywhere about it. When Qin Senior Sister found out I'd sold her returned Amulet for such an outrageous price of eight hundred, she was furious enough to almost spit blood. She rushed over right after school to demand back her two hundred dollars. This was indeed unfair on my part; all I could do was say that I was discussing getting her a good Amulet from Second Uncle and that any extra money wouldn't be charged back to her—I would cover it myself. Upon hearing this, Qin Senior Sister's anger finally subsided. 0
 
When I picked up my phone again, Second Uncle was already waiting impatiently on the other end and said: "You little rascal! Using my goods to chase girls?" 0
 
 
I chuckled and said, "How could that be? I was just joking. By the way, do you have any amulets under five hundred that can help someone reconcile? Authentic ones are best, but they must show results quickly, like within two or three days." 0
 
"Do you think this is grocery shopping?" Second Uncle replied irritably. "Authentic ones don't work that well; otherwise, why would I have made so many connections with Achan? Besides, even the cheapest talisman would cost five hundred in Thailand, and sending it to mainland China would incur losses. You need to have some sense when chasing girls; what progress have you made to start throwing money around? Have you even kissed her yet?" 0
 
I broke into a cold sweat when I saw Qin Senior Sister looking at us with suspicion. I dared not say more and kept pleading with him. Second Uncle had spoiled me since I was little and had hardly ever refused my requests. He was merely reminding me not to give up my career for a woman; he didn't really care about that small amount of money. He told me that five hundred could buy a Composite Yantong Ling, but at that price, Achan wouldn't make it too powerful, and I'd still need to add some Mind Control Powder for assistance. 0
 
I asked Qin Senior Sister if she was really sure about wanting her sister to reconcile with her boyfriend. Honestly, I didn't agree with this; if they had separated due to irreconcilable issues, there was no need to seek the help of supernatural forces for reconciliation. Acting against one's true feelings would only deplete one's luck in advance. 0
 
Qin Senior Sister hesitated for a moment and then nodded in confirmation. I asked Second Uncle to send the amulet as soon as possible and inquired about any taboos associated with it. Just as I was about to hang up, Second Uncle suddenly told me to wait a moment. I heard him speaking to someone on the phone in Thai, which I couldn't understand. 0
 
After a while, he asked me, "Where's that person you sold the Wealth-Inviting Spirit Child Ghost to last time?" 0
 
I was taken aback and replied, "I don't know; he hasn't been coming to school anymore. He’s probably at some casino. Why do you want to know?" 0
 
"Still gambling?" Second Uncle's tone changed; he sounded quite angry. "What do you mean by asking about him? The Ajan Master who makes the Wealth-Inviting Spirit Child Ghost is right next to me. He came to say that no matter what, the Spirit Child can't be summoned back and wanted me to ask about the Victim's situation. What kind of business are you running? Always causing problems! If it weren't for the Ajan Master's responsibility, I wouldn't even know about this mess." 0
 
I was startled and instinctively calculated the time; it seemed like it had already been over a month without summoning back the Spirit Child? Second Uncle seemed to remember something and asked, "By the way, last time you asked me what taboos there were for summoning back the Spirit Child. Was that person trying to trick you into revealing information?" 0
 
I was stunned for a moment. Trick me? Thinking back carefully, Zheng Xuezhang had asked when there were only a few days left until the Spirit Child was supposed to be summoned back, and after that, he hadn't contacted me again. Logically speaking, regardless of whether the Spirit Child had been taken by Achan or not, he should have checked in on the situation to prevent any accidents. Could it be that he was indeed trying to trick me into revealing information so he could keep the Spirit Child and continue gambling? 0
 
It wasn't impossible; I remembered clearly how crazy both father and son had been back then. 0
